Mercer, IL Website Design and Programming
Website Design and Programming Mercer, Illinois
Mercer Cities
Latitude for Mercer is 41.201226 Latitude and -90.73032 Longitude
Website Design, Programming, SEO and Lead Generation
Website Design and Programming Mercer, Illinois
Latitude for Mercer is 41.201226 Latitude and -90.73032 Longitude